Yo Cobblers - how hard is that remapping shiz to learn?  My Forester is running like a bag of shite at low speeds and I reckon it's overfuelling badly - it's supposed to have been remapped in the past, and I'm not sure it was very well done.  I don't want to start forking out for a tuner to sort it if I can get the gubbins to do it myself.

 

To be honest a remap is unlikely to make any difference at all to low speed running, generally you won't even touch anything other than 80% + load, 2500rpm+ and unlike faffing with carbs etc etc, it's pretty straightforward to make changes exactly where you want to without affecting anywhere else.

 

It's taken me probably a few weeks of a couple of hours a day reading and tinkering to really get familiar enough with what I'm doing, but I'm lucky that there's a real wealth of info on my particular ECU/engine because it's fitted to flipping EVERYTHING  from 2000 to 2010. Without all that I don't think I'd have been able to do it. Even with pages and pages of info, It's all got quite a steep learning curve - There's no "how to do a stage 1 remap" thread, so I basically wrote one for myself.

Been servicing the big mower in preparation for the coming season. John Deere parts are mega-pricey, but a bit of pricking about on the internet revealed that the engine oil filter is the same as that of a Smart car and the transmission oil filter is the same as the engine oil filter fitted to some Nissans - Bought them from an online supplier and saved a big dose of cash.
